FS728TLP - Unable to schedule PoE timer across different days

When trying to set a global timer schedule on a FS728TLP switch it looks like you are unable to set schedules that stretch beyond the 'Shutdown Time Start' of the 'Date Start' field. (attaching screenshot of error message)

An example of the situation one of customers would like to utilise:

We would like to have the PoE ports power off for the evening and come back online the following morning, i.e. ports should power down at 4pm in the evening and come back online the following morning at 7am.

 

This is not possible with this caveat that exists on the FS728TLP switch. The FS728TPv1 and  FS728TPv2 are capable of setting these requirements.

 

Can this feature be added for the FS728TLP switch?
